WebApplicants for U.S. visas are required to appear in person for an appointment at the Visa Application Center (VAC) and the visa interview at the U.S. Embassy or Consulate. You must schedule the VAC appointment at least one day before the interview appointment date. You can schedule both appointments, either online using this website or through ... To apply for a U.S. visa, each applicant, including children, are required to pay a visa application fee. Such fees are also called MRV fees. U.S. visa application fees are non-refundable and non-tranferrable. Even though the U.S. visa fees are fixed in U.S. dollars, the Indian Rupee equivalent ...

WebIs the F-1 visa stamp in your passport valid beyond the date you plan to re-enter the United States? If not, you must apply for a new visa stamp while you are abroad. Read about renewing your visa » Travel to Countries Other Than Your Home Country. Review the U.S. Embassy or Consulate website where you will apply for your visa for location specific information. When renewing your visa, anticipate delays, especially if you will be traveling during holiday or peak travel seasons.
